首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将Object.keys().map()函数中的参数设置为新对象中的键?

要将Object.keys().map()函数中的参数设置为新对象中的键,可以使用箭头函数和对象解构的方式来实现。

首先,Object.keys()函数可以返回一个给定对象的所有可枚举属性的数组。然后,可以使用.map()函数对该数组进行遍历和转换操作。

在.map()函数中,可以使用箭头函数来定义转换规则。箭头函数的参数即为Object.keys()返回的数组中的每个元素,可以将其解构为一个新的对象键。

下面是一个示例代码:

代码语言:txt
复制
const obj = {
  key1: 'value1',
  key2: 'value2',
  key3: 'value3'
};

const newObj = Object.keys(obj).map(key => ({ [key]: obj[key] }));

console.log(newObj);

在上述代码中,首先定义了一个包含多个键值对的对象obj。然后使用Object.keys()函数获取obj的所有键,返回一个数组。接着使用.map()函数对该数组进行遍历和转换操作。

在箭头函数中,使用对象解构的方式将数组中的每个元素解构为一个新的对象键。最后,将新的对象作为.map()函数的返回值,形成一个新的数组newObj。

运行上述代码,将会输出以下结果:

代码语言:txt
复制
[ { key1: 'value1' }, { key2: 'value2' }, { key3: 'value3' } ]

在这个示例中,Object.keys().map()函数的参数被设置为新对象中的键,每个键对应原始对象obj中的相应值。这样就实现了将Object.keys().map()函数中的参数设置为新对象中的键的功能。

腾讯云相关产品和产品介绍链接地址:

  • 云函数(Serverless):https://cloud.tencent.com/product/scf
  • 云数据库 MongoDB 版:https://cloud.tencent.com/product/cynosdb-for-mongodb
  • 云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 云原生应用引擎(TKE):https://cloud.tencent.com/product/tke
  • 云存储(COS):https://cloud.tencent.com/product/cos
  • 人工智能(AI):https://cloud.tencent.com/product/ai
  • 物联网(IoT):https://cloud.tencent.com/product/iotexplorer
  • 移动开发(移动推送):https://cloud.tencent.com/product/umeng
  • 区块链(BCS):https://cloud.tencent.com/product/bcs
  • 元宇宙(Qcloud Metaverse):https://cloud.tencent.com/product/qcloud-metaverse
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

29分44秒

Web前端 TS教程 09.TypeScript中对象和函数的类型声明 学习猿地

27分0秒

day15_面向对象(下)/22-尚硅谷-Java语言基础-Java8中接口的新特性

27分0秒

day15_面向对象(下)/22-尚硅谷-Java语言基础-Java8中接口的新特性

27分0秒

day15_面向对象(下)/22-尚硅谷-Java语言基础-Java8中接口的新特性

7分1秒

086.go的map遍历

5分8秒

084.go的map定义

6分33秒

088.sync.Map的比较相关方法

36分12秒

1.尚硅谷全套JAVA教程--基础必备(67.32GB)/尚硅谷Java入门教程,java电子书+Java面试真题(2023新版)/08_授课视频/121-面向对象(高级)-IDEA中快捷键的使用和修改.mp4

1分7秒

PS小白教程:如何在Photoshop中给风景照添加光线效果?

4分36秒

PS小白教程:如何在Photoshop中制作雨天玻璃文字效果?

21分26秒

1.尚硅谷全套JAVA教程--基础必备(67.32GB)/尚硅谷Java入门教程,java电子书+Java面试真题(2023新版)/08_授课视频/115-面向对象(高级)-JDK8和JDK9中接口的新特性.mp4

1分10秒

PS小白教程:如何在Photoshop中制作透明玻璃效果?

领券